My client a leading UK Insurer are looking to bring on a Mid-Market Specialist to join their Commercial Lines Regional Trading team, reporting in to a Trading Lead. This person will be aligned to a portfolio of brokers/customers to proactively and profitably grow their business, as well as develop and implement underwriting strategy for lines of business in the region.
The role-holder will be a Technical Owner and Class Specialist, working closely with the RUM, Head of Trading and Trading Leads. This role is seen as a senior one of autonomy, large-scale responsibility and influence as the individual owns strategy creation.
My client offers flexible working, and this person can be based anywhere in the UK, as long as they are comfortable regularly travelling to the London office and meeting brokers.
The role's duties & responsibilities:
Regional multi-class underwriting within agreed guidelines and authority levels to profitably grow the business with a technical specialism and enhanced licence in a core class
Developing and implementing the underwriting strategies
Proactively develop & profitably grow commercial books of business with aligned portfolio of customers/brokers
Have regular meaningful face-to-face meetings with customers and brokers to build their confidence and make this an insurer of choice
Mentoring and coaching less experienced colleagues in writing and winning more complex, higher value business
Actively participating in lead underwriter forums nationally and locally
Leading the team in the absence of the Underwriting Leader
Skills & experiences required:
Previous commercial underwriting experience ideally with a bias to Liability EL,PL and Products) with areas of specialism, such as (Real Estate, Technology) a real advantage
Strong commercial business acumen to build and deliver business cases and the curiosity to grow this understanding
Experience of analysing risks, communicating and presenting effectively to brokers and customers
Background of excellent communication, listening, time management and negotiating skills
Good knowledge of the FCA and other relevant regulation and legislation
Diploma or fully ACII qualified
